Hey all,

Had a quick search but couldn't see anything.

Going to be replacing the head gasket on my ZXR in the next few weeks, was just wondering if there's anything else I should replace/check while I have the engine all apart? I've read you should probably replace the cam chain, and maybe the tensioner aswell.

Anything else?

Cheers, Laith.

There no reason to replace the head gasket unless it is actually blown ? ? ?



when a head is off I'd be checking rocker arms, re-lapping valves, considering new valve stem oil seals, inspect camshafts, replace cam chain inspect cam chain tensioner, inspect tensioner blade. Id do a good external clean of the engine too before I took the head off and do a good clean of the frame too while the engine is out
